Output 85e3084522833ef5a944c48005876446d1f3776d14f656f64892f5ad5399507a:0

value
93700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01d0dde0c46329225e11dce9e3a6444f0b983217 OP_EQUALVERIFY OP_CHECKSIG
address
1AbtWJuf7Tw3vHuYudXT7DmZiTqSgGGPX
transaction
85e3084522833ef5a944c48005876446d1f3776d14f656f64892f5ad5399507a
spent
true